    One-of-a-kind by Alissa

    MyTennisFashion had a chance to talk with San Francisco based designer Alissa Anderson earlier this week. Her unique concept of turning Vintage Racket bag covers into colorful unique luggage tags, cardholders, wallets and other travel accessories is truly something special.

    Q  Alissa, do you come from a tennis playing background ?

    A. Embarrassingly, I am not a frequent tennis player, although I did play in summer camp as a kid!

    Q. Take us back to what started the whole mittenmaker concept and what was the inspiration behind it?

    A. Mittenmaker started as a recycled fashion line about 7 years ago, soon after I moved to San Francisco. I mostly made reconstructed t-shirts but began to make little vinyl card holders (the ones I still sell now) and got a great response to them. Since I only use recycled materials I was trying to think of a good source of recycled vinyl. One day I found a vintage tennis racquet cover at a thrift store, loved the vinyl and the logo, and the rest is history!

    Q  I see your products all fit into the whole eco-friendly recycle and reuse movement. Was this something that you were always into?

    A. Yes, I have always valued recycling and reusing things, for political as well as aesthetic reasons. The tennis theme sort of happened accidentally while looking for a source of recycled vinyl, and I’m so happy it did! I also LOVE thrifting so now I get to scour thrift stores everywhere with a specific goal. I also use other sources of recycled vinyl for the insides of the wallets such as old chairs, couches, and luggage.

    Q How long have selling your products?

    A   I have been selling my tennis products on Etsy since 2005 and also about 2 years before that at events in San Francisco, so at least 5 or 6 years now.

    Q What has the response been so far?

    A. People have always really appreciated the cleverness of materials and minimal design, but Etsy really helped me get my products out there in the world. I have sent orders to dozens of different states and countries.

    Q  Is each item hand made and do you sew them yourself ?

    A. Yes, I love sewing! I design the products, make the patterns, and sew everything myself on my trusty industrial sewing machine in my sewing studio. Occasionally friends come over to help me clean covers, which takes a lot of time and elbow grease, as many of them are pretty dirty from being in garages, attics, sheds, etc.

    Q  What does the future look like for mittenmaker?

    A I n addition to Mittenmaker I am also a photographer, travel with a band, and work at a motorcycle shop! I’ve been touring a lot lately so it has been hard to keep my Etsy store well-stocked, but I hope to be more productive in the next few months and maybe even come up with a couple of new designs. Also, I would love to collaborate on eco-friendly and vintage-inspired designs with a major tennis brand.

    Q I understand you were recently featured in Tennis Magazine. What was the response like after that major exposure?

    A. The response I’ve gotten from the Tennis Magazine article has been amazing! As soon as it hit newsstands I got a lot of orders, way more than usual. A lot of tennis fans and players wrote me who were really stoked to find out about such fun, unique, and eco/vintage themed tennis products. Also some professional players contacted me who bought products with the logo of the company they’re sponsored by, which is so exciting! My products were always popular among people who valued recycling and reuse, but the magazine article really helped alert the tennis community to my work, which is something I’ve always dreamed about. In July I’ll be working with the Stanford Bank of the West Classic, which I’m really looking forward to.

    Q. What is the best way to purchase your product? Do you also have a store location in San Francisco?

    A. Currently in addition to my webstore at www.mittenmaker.etsy.com you can also buy them in person at Little Otsu in San Francisco. I also do many fashion and craft events in the Bay Area, and even sell them at the merch table on the road.

    Q. You know I can’t let you leave without asking you, who is your favorite tennis player?

    A. At the moment I don’t have a favorite player, although as someone with a fashion background I love watching the fierce Williams sisters play! Even just to check out their outfits.
